İstediğim Teknik Özellikler
Puppeteer tabanlı
Tarayıcıya ait fingerprint değerleri spoof edilecek (gerçek kullanıcı gibi görünecek)
- Canvas, WebGL, AudioContext
- Fonts, Screen, Navigator.plugins
- DeviceMemory, HardwareConcurrency
- Touch Support, MediaDevices, Battery
- Timezone, Languages, Platform, User-Agent
- WebRTC, IndexedDB
- User-Agent, Accept, Accept-Language, Accept-Encoding, Connection
- Sec-CH-UA, Sec-Fetch-Site, Sec-Fetch-User, Sec-Fetch-Dest, Sec-Fetch-Mode
- Upgrade-Insecure-Requests, TE, DNT gibi gerçekçi tarayıcı header’ları
Tarayıcı bir kez açıldığında, kullanılan fingerprint oturum boyunca aynı kalmalı ve hiçbir işlem sırasında değişmemeli.
İlk yüklenen spoof bilgileriyle, tüm işlemler (sayfa geçişleri dahil) o fingerprint altında yürütülmeli.
evaluateOnNewDocument() ile tüm spoof işlemleri sayfa yüklenmeden önce yapılacak
setupStealth.js gibi merkezi bir dosya ile tüm spoof işlemleri yönetilebilir olacak
Tüm fingerprint verileri random değil, tutarlı olacak (birbirini destekleyen sahte değerler)
reCAPTCHA v3 gibi sistemlerde 0.7+ skor verebilecek kadar doğal olacak
Tarayıcı test sitelerinde bot olarak algılanmayacak:
Proxy uyumlu çalışmalı (ben IP döngüsünü dışarıdan bağlayacağım)
Kod açık, modüler, yorumlu olacak — üstüne işlem ekleyebileyim
Teslimatta Olması Gerekenler:
- Tam çalışır örnek proje (örnek kullanım dosyası index.js)
- Gerekli tüm dosyalarla birlikte çalışan spoof altyapısı
- Tarayıcıyı açtığında otomatik olarak tüm fingerprint işlemleri yapılmış olacak
- Test sitelerinden alınmış örnek ekran görüntüleri/demolar